About

Introduction / Overview

For New York residents seeking a long-term, welcoming outdoor retreat in the stunning Finger Lakes region, Lake Grove Park in Alpine, NY, offers a unique destination camping experience. More than just a transient stopover, Lake Grove Park is designed to be a true community where campers can relax, connect, and enjoy the beauty of Upstate New York along the edge of picturesque Cayuta Lake.

Established in 1948, the Park has a rich history rooted in providing affordable outdoor recreation. Over the years, it has continuously evolved, with a significant emphasis on upgrading its infrastructure to provide modern comforts. Since 2000, Lake Grove Park has undergone extensive, approved improvements to its septic, water, and electric services, positioning it as a leader in enhanced amenities among local campgrounds. This commitment to quality ensures a reliable and superior experience for all campers.

The Park spans approximately 60 acres, thoughtfully designed to maximize access to Cayuta Lake while preserving natural spaces, including preserved wildlife corridors and a 'Forest Primeval' area for exploration. Location and Accessibility

Lake Grove Park’s location at 2619 Co Rte 6, Alpine, NY 14805, places it in a prime position to enjoy the best of the Southern Finger Lakes. Its setting on the eastern shore of Cayuta Lake provides direct, private lakefront access, a significant advantage for New York boaters and anglers.

Regional Hub Proximity: The Park is strategically located just a short drive from major cultural and recreational hubs. It’s an easy commute to Ithaca, home to major universities and a vibrant food scene, and is also convenient to Corning, famous for the Corning Museum of Glass. The world-renowned Finger Lakes Wine Country, with its dozens of wineries and breweries, is only a "hop and a skip" away, making day trips a breeze.

Gateway to Natural Wonders: The location is a superb gateway to the celebrated natural attractions of the area. It is only about seven miles from Watkins Glen State Park, famous for its magnificent gorge and waterfalls, and equally close to other natural gems like Buttermilk Falls State Park and the expansive Finger Lakes National Forest. This proximity to state parks offers unlimited hiking, trail biking, and sightseeing opportunities right outside the campground.

Direct Lake Access: A major draw for New York campers is the location on Cayuta Lake. The Park features its own private boat launch, allowing residents and campers immediate access to the 388-acre lake for fishing, boating, and general water recreation. For those interested in the lake's history, the park also maintains an accessible historical corridor with three stations, detailing the area's background.

Services Offered

Lake Grove Park focuses on providing a secure and amenity-rich environment, primarily catering to seasonal and destination camping rather than nightly stays. The services reflect a commitment to a settled, high-quality camping lifestyle.

  • Upgraded Utilities: The park features upgraded septic, water, and electric services, with new electric boards compatible with modern smart meters, ensuring reliable and robust utility access for RVs and camp units.
  • Connectivity: The recent installation of fiber for PARKnet enhances internet connectivity throughout the north end of the park, a crucial amenity for long-term campers.
  • Long-Term Camping and Unit Sales: The Park’s primary model is seasonal leases. They also facilitate the sale of eligible units (campers/RVs) already in the Park, including the transfer of their campsite lease, making it easier for new New York residents to establish a seasonal home.
  • Private Water Access: A private boat launch is available for campers to use, granting superior access to Cayuta Lake compared to public options.
  • Waste Management: Off-street parking is provided, and trash pickup is included in the services, contributing to a clean and well-managed environment.
